Commit 1d6165e6 authored by LiXuyang's avatar LiXuyang

逻辑模型设计-模型发布-修改

parent 07e372ee
......@@ -46,6 +46,7 @@ export const TreeData = [
export const logicalData: any[] = [
{
businessId: 1,
modelName: '逻辑模型1',
EngName: 'modelOne',
describe: '逻辑模型1,数据多',
......@@ -57,6 +58,7 @@ export const logicalData: any[] = [
themeId: '1-1-1',
},
{
businessId: 2,
modelName: '逻辑模型2',
EngName: 'modelTwo',
describe: '逻辑模型2,数据少',
......@@ -68,6 +70,7 @@ export const logicalData: any[] = [
themeId: '1-1-1',
},
{
businessId: 3,
modelName: '逻辑模型3',
EngName: 'modelThree',
describe: '逻辑模型3,数据很多',
......@@ -79,6 +82,7 @@ export const logicalData: any[] = [
themeId: '1-1-2',
},
{
businessId: 4,
modelName: '逻辑模型4',
EngName: 'model4',
describe: '逻辑模型4,数据少',
......@@ -90,6 +94,7 @@ export const logicalData: any[] = [
themeId: '1-1-2',
},
{
businessId: 5,
modelName: '逻辑模型5',
EngName: 'model5',
describe: '逻辑模型5,数据很多',
......@@ -101,6 +106,7 @@ export const logicalData: any[] = [
themeId: '1-2-1',
},
{
businessId: 6,
modelName: '一级主体域1',
EngName: 'themeOne',
describe: '知识库模型3,数据很多',
......@@ -112,6 +118,7 @@ export const logicalData: any[] = [
themeId: '1-1',
},
{
businessId: 7,
modelName: '一级主体域2',
EngName: 'themeTwo',
describe: '知识库模型3,数据很多',
......@@ -123,6 +130,7 @@ export const logicalData: any[] = [
themeId: '1-2',
},
{
businessId: 8,
modelName: '一级主体域3',
EngName: 'themeThree',
describe: '知识库模型3,数据很多',
......
......@@ -11,8 +11,10 @@
<a-button type="primary" v-if="!editFlag" @click="handleExport">导出</a-button>
<a-button type="primary" v-if="!editFlag" @click="handleEdit">编辑</a-button>
<a-button type="primary" v-if="!editFlag" @click="handleDelete">删除</a-button>
<a-button type="primary" v-if="editFlag" @click="handleWaitUpload">设为待发布</a-button>
<a-button type="primary" v-if="editFlag">发布</a-button>
<a-button type="primary" v-if="editFlag" @click="handleWaitUpload">{{
isUpload ? '取消待发布' : '设为待发布'
}}</a-button>
<a-button type="primary" v-if="editFlag" :disabled="!isUpload" @click="handleUpload">发布</a-button>
<a-button type="primary" v-if="editFlag" @click="handleSave">保存</a-button>
<a-button type="primary" v-if="editFlag" @click="handleCancel">取消</a-button>
</template>
......@@ -131,6 +133,7 @@
const route = useRoute();
const searchInfo = reactive<Recordable>({});
const modelName = route.query.modelName;
const isUpload = ref(false);
/**
* 属性定义
*/
......@@ -267,15 +270,19 @@
* 设为待发布
*/
function handleWaitUpload() {
createConfirm({
iconType: 'success',
title: '设为待发布成功',
okText: '发布',
content: '设为待发布成功,是否选择发布?',
onOk() {
createMessage.success('发布成功!');
},
});
isUpload.value = !isUpload.value;
// createConfirm({
// iconType: 'success',
// title: '设为待发布成功',
// okText: '发布',
// content: '设为待发布成功,是否选择发布?',
// onOk() {
// createMessage.success('发布成功!');
// },
// });
}
function handleUpload() {
}
/**
* 保存
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ment